Savage, hostile, and cruel
Some may find puzzling or distasteful the parallel I am drawing between the study of nature and the study of technology. After all, nature is good and good for you, whereas everyone knows that technology is ugly, evil, and dangerous.
A few centuries ago—say, on the American western frontier—a quite different view prevailed. Nature was seen as savage, hostile, cruel. Mountains and forests were barriers, not refuges. The lights of civilization were a comforting sight. We took our charter from the book of Genesis, which grants mankind dominion over the beasts, and felt it was both our entitlement and our duty to tame the wilderness, fell the trees, plow the land, and dam the rivers.

Scales of cities, scales of software
An Article by Linus the SephistAmerican cities seem like a product of industrial processes where older European cities seem like a product of human processes. This is because most American cities were built after and alongside the car and the industrial revolution – the design of cities took into account what was easily possible, and that guided the shape and scale of everything.
Software has similar analogues. There are software codebases that feel much more industrially generated than hand written, and they’re usually written in automation-rich environments fitting into frameworks and other orchestrating code.
…But despite the availability of cars, I still much prefer the scale and ambiance of European, human-scale cities, because ultimately cities are places humans must inhabit and understand. In the same way, I still much prefer the scale and ambiance of hand-written codebases even in the presence of heavy programming tooling, because ultimately codebases are places humans must inhabit.

A representational tension
Do I need to know the precise polygonal geometries of Los Angeles and the University of Southern California to assert that the latter is within the former? No. My mind contains no such precise geometric model of points and lines, yet I know that USC is in Los Angeles. When humans reason with the real world, they focus on its objects, relations, and processes—rather than starting with geometry—because these are the keys to understanding and explaining the real world. Our GIS tools, however, usually do the opposite. Built from the geometry-up around the legacy logic of traditional cartography (geometries and layers), most GIS tools today are restricted by that legacy’s limited ability to model objects, relations, and processes. A representational tension thus exists in GIScience between being a geometric information science versus an ontological, relational, and processual information science.

Software often feels inevitable
Software often feels inevitable because its backstory is often invisible. We click a download link, run an installer, and suddenly have a new tool to use. Yet this conceals years of human decisions, experiences, and constraints shaping software outcomes that are in no way pre-destined.
